@mantine/core
Version:
React components library focused on usability, accessibility and developer experience
22 lines (21 loc) • 794 B
JavaScript
"use client";
import { Box } from "../../core/Box/Box.mjs";
import { useModalBaseContext } from "./ModalBase.context.mjs";
import { useModalBodyId } from "./use-modal-body-id.mjs";
import ModalBase_module_default from "./ModalBase.module.mjs";
import cx from "clsx";
import { jsx } from "react/jsx-runtime";
//#region packages/@mantine/core/src/components/ModalBase/ModalBaseBody.tsx
function ModalBaseBody({ className, ...others }) {
const bodyId = useModalBodyId();
const ctx = useModalBaseContext();
return /* @__PURE__ */ jsx(Box, {
id: bodyId,
className: cx({ [ModalBase_module_default.body]: !ctx.unstyled }, className),
...others
});
}
ModalBaseBody.displayName = "@mantine/core/ModalBaseBody";
//#endregion
export { ModalBaseBody };
//# sourceMappingURL=ModalBaseBody.mjs.map